Hello,

I have an issue when adding entries to DB. for some reason im getting
this autput:


[root@ldap]# slapadd -f /etc/openldap/slapd.conf -l
/home/tculjaga/export.ldif -q -c



str2entry: entry -1 has multiple DNs
"lbsID=100,uniqueID=38512331810,ou=redirec" and
"uniqueID=38512322963,ou=redirecting,ou=sipDirektor,dc=ot,dc=hr"
slapadd: could not parse entry (line=1727833)


str2entry: entry -1 has multiple DNs "lbsID=100,uniqueID=385138" and
"uniqueID=38513899170,ou=redirecting,ou=sipDirektor,dc=ot,dc=hr"
slapadd: could not parse entry (line=10487774)
str2entry: entry -1 has multiple DNs
"lbsID=100,uniqueID=38514552151,ou=redirecting,ou=sipDirektor,dc=ot,dc=hr"
and "uniqueID=38514558227,ou=redirecting,ou=sipDirektor,dc=ot,dc=hr"
slapadd: could not parse entry (line=10895623)



Can someone please explain whats wrong ?


also, i went to lines listed above and found nothing strange at all ...


any help ?

Hi,

It looks like your LDIF file is malformed around these lines. In particular, are there white lines between each entry (an entry begins with a line starting with "dn:")?

If you post an extract (or point to a pastebin) of the problematic LDIF file here we may be able to provide more specific help.
